Output 52bf9c8b9fbb35204f4c17841e276974bbca1c5a39539ff863d5515b8a80164a:31

value
84790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 711aa81b65ea1a843fc0c6169bb3daaa4824d742 OP_EQUAL
address
3C14DMjmfde9TyRq6sjeUDE64NV1BVwqs7
transaction
52bf9c8b9fbb35204f4c17841e276974bbca1c5a39539ff863d5515b8a80164a
spent
true